How to Style a Boho Midi Dress for Different Occasions
Now, you might be wondering: How do I style this for every occasion? Well, that’s the beauty of a boho midi dress. With a few tweaks, you can go from a laid-back afternoon to a night out.
Daytime Brunch or Picnic
For a chill day out, keep things relaxed. Pair your dress with some cute sandals and a wide-brimmed hat, and you’re good to go. It’s comfy, it’s cute, and you’ll feel like you stepped right out of a movie scene.
- Casual Sandals: Keep it simple and comfy.
- Minimal Jewelry: A few bangles or hoop earrings work wonders.
- Tote Bag: Something large and practical for that laid-back look.
Think about it – a fresh breeze, sunshine, and a floral dress. Isn’t that the ideal Saturday?
Evening Out or Date Night
Want to dress it up? Just add a few bolder accessories, maybe a leather jacket for a bit of edge, and switch those sandals for heels or ankle boots. It’s amazing how a few changes can make this dress feel totally different.
- Bold Jewelry: Try statement earrings or a chunky necklace.
- Leather or Denim Jacket: For an edgy vibe.
- Heels or Ankle Boots: Instantly elevates the look.
You’ll be surprised how effortlessly you go from daytime cute to nighttime chic!
